Classifications are generally pictured in the form of hierarchical trees, also called dendrograms. A dendrogram is the graphical
representation of an ultrametric (=cophenetic) matrix; so dendrograms can be compared to one another by comparing their cophenetic
matrices. Three methods used in testing the correlation between matrices corresponding to dendrograms are evaluated. The three
permutational procedures make use of different aspects of the information to compare dendrograms: the Mantel procedure permutes
label positions only; the binary tree methods randomize the topology as well; the double-permutation procedure is based on
all the information included in a dendrogram, that is: topology, label positions, and cluster heights. Theoretical and empirical
investigations of these methods are carried out to evaluate their relative performance. Simulations show that the Mantel test
is too conservative when applied to the comparison of dendrograms; the methods of binary tree comparisons do slightly better;
only the doublepermutation test provides unbiased type I error.

Assouad has shown that a real-valued distance d = (dij)1 ≤ i < j ≤ n is isometrically embeddable in ℓ1space if and only if it belongs to the cut cone on n points. Determining if this condition holds is NP-complete. We use Assouad's
result in a constructive column generation algorithm for ℓ1-embeddability. The subproblem is an unconstrained 0-1 quadratic program, solved by Tabu Search and Variable Neighborhood
Search heuristics as well as by an exact enumerative algorithm. Computational results are reported. Several ways to approximate
a distance which is not ℓ1-embeddable by another one which is are also studied. 相似文献

The adult brain most probably reaches its highest degree of plasticity with the lifelong generation and integration of new
neurons in the hippocampus and olfactory system. Neural precursor cells (NPCs) residing both in the subgranular zone of the
dentate gyrus and in the subventricular zone of the lateral ventricles continuously generate neurons that populate the dentate
gyrus and the olfactory bulb, respectively. The regulation of NPC proliferation in the adult brain has been widely investigated
in the past few years. Yet, the intrinsic cell cycle machinery underlying NPC proliferation remains largely unexplored. In
this review, we discuss the cell cycle components that are involved in the regulation of NPC proliferation in both neurogenic
areas of the adult brain. 相似文献

The double-stranded RNA binding domain (dsRBD) is a small protein domain of 65–70 amino acids adopting an αβββα fold, whose central property is to bind to double-stranded RNA (dsRNA). This domain is present in proteins implicated in many aspects of cellular life, including antiviral response, RNA editing, RNA processing, RNA transport and, last but not least, RNA silencing. Even though proteins containing dsRBDs can bind to very specific dsRNA targets in vivo, the binding of dsRBDs to dsRNA is commonly believed to be shape-dependent rather than sequence-specific. Interestingly, recent structural information on dsRNA recognition by dsRBDs opens the possibility that this domain performs a direct readout of RNA sequence in the minor groove, allowing a global reconsideration of the principles describing dsRNA recognition by dsRBDs. We review in this article the current structural and molecular knowledge on dsRBDs, emphasizing the intricate relationship between the amino acid sequence, the structure of the domain and its RNA recognition capacity. We especially focus on the molecular determinants of dsRNA recognition and describe how sequence discrimination can be achieved by this type of domain. 相似文献

Using the method of ARIMA forecasting with benchmarks developed in this paper, it is possible to obtain forecasts which take into account the historical information of a series, captured by an ARIMA model (Box and Jenkins, 1970), as well as partial prior information about the forecasts. Prior information takes the form of benchmarks. These originate from the advice of experts, from forecasts of an annual econometric model or simply from pessimistic, realistic or optimistic scenarios contemplated by the analyst of the current economic situation. The benchmarks may represent annual levels to be achieved, neighbourhoods to be reached for a given time period, movements to be displayed or more generally any linear criteria to be satisfied by the forecasted values. The forecaster may then exercise his current economic evaluation and judgement to the fullest extent in deriving forecasts, since the laboriousness experienced without a systematic method is avoided. 相似文献

To identify genetic variants influencing plasma lipid concentrations, we first used genotype imputation and meta-analysis to combine three genome-wide scans totaling 8,816 individuals and comprising 6,068 individuals specific to our study (1,874 individuals from the FUSION study of type 2 diabetes and 4,184 individuals from the SardiNIA study of aging-associated variables) and 2,758 individuals from the Diabetes Genetics Initiative, reported in a companion study in this issue. We subsequently examined promising signals in 11,569 additional individuals. Overall, we identify strongly associated variants in eleven loci previously implicated in lipid metabolism (ABCA1, the APOA5-APOA4-APOC3-APOA1 and APOE-APOC clusters, APOB, CETP, GCKR, LDLR, LPL, LIPC, LIPG and PCSK9) and also in several newly identified loci (near MVK-MMAB and GALNT2, with variants primarily associated with high-density lipoprotein (HDL) cholesterol; near SORT1, with variants primarily associated with low-density lipoprotein (LDL) cholesterol; near TRIB1, MLXIPL and ANGPTL3, with variants primarily associated with triglycerides; and a locus encompassing several genes near NCAN, with variants strongly associated with both triglycerides and LDL cholesterol). Notably, the 11 independent variants associated with increased LDL cholesterol concentrations in our study also showed increased frequency in a sample of coronary artery disease cases versus controls. 相似文献
